Evaluation of the Sexually Abused Child

A Medical Textbook and Photographic Atlas

Astrid Heger , S. Jean Herriot Emans

Family & Relationships / Abuse / Child Abuse

While awareness of child sexual abuse has increased greatly, physicians have traditionally received little or no training in evaluating suspected abuse. This is the first medical book to combine a step-by-step discussion of how to interview and evaluate sexually abused children with a complete
photographic atlas containing 120 color illustrations documenting signs of abuse. Chapters in the text deal with such topics as the psychological aspects of abuse, sexually transmitted diseases, the forensic team, and the role of the physician in court. This volume is a comprehensive and
authoritative resource for pediatricians and all other primary care physicians who see children in their practice.
